"""Context Debugger — diagnoses bad model outputs by analyzing context quality.
Inspects a ContextPack for common issues (redundancy, staleness, low diversity,
budget waste, wrong priorities) and produces actionable recommendations.
"""
from __future__ import annotations
from dataclasses import dataclass, field
from typing import Any
from .core import Budget, ContextItem, ContextPack, pack
from .quality import ContextQuality, analyze_context
from .relevance import compute_relevance, normalize_query
# ---------------------------------------------------------------------------
# Types
# ---------------------------------------------------------------------------
@dataclass
class QualityThresholds:
"""Thresholds for diagnostic checks."""
min_density: float = 0.3
min_diversity: float = 0.4
max_redundancy: float = 0.3
min_freshness: float = 0.2
min_utilization: float = 0.5
max_utilization: float = 0.95
@dataclass
class DiagnosticIssue:
"""A single diagnostic finding."""
severity: str # "info" | "warning" | "critical"
category: str # "missing-context" | "redundancy" | "stale-context" | "budget-waste" | "wrong-priorities" | "low-diversity"
message: str
evidence: dict[str, Any] = field(default_factory=dict)
@dataclass
class Recommendation:
"""An actionable recommendation to improve context quality."""
action: str # "adjust-weights" | "increase-budget" | "add-kind" | "remove-kind" | "enable-compression" | "enable-redundancy-filter"
description: str
suggested_change: dict[str, Any] = field(default_factory=dict)
estimated_impact: str = ""
@dataclass
class DroppedAnalysis:
"""Analysis of items that were dropped during packing."""
total_dropped: int
dropped_by_kind: dict[str, int]
high_priority_dropped: list[ContextItem]
potentially_relevant: list[ContextItem]
@dataclass
class Diagnosis:
"""Complete diagnostic result for a context pack."""
overall_health: str # "good" | "warning" | "critical"
quality: ContextQuality
issues: list[DiagnosticIssue]
recommendations: list[Recommendation]
dropped_analysis: DroppedAnalysis
@dataclass
class ComparisonResult:
"""Result of comparing two context packs."""
pack_a_quality: ContextQuality
pack_b_quality: ContextQuality
item_diff: dict[str, list[str]] # only_in_a, only_in_b, shared
quality_delta: float
insights: list[str]
# ---------------------------------------------------------------------------
# Analyzers (private helpers)
# ---------------------------------------------------------------------------
def _analyze_redundancy(
quality: ContextQuality,
thresholds: QualityThresholds,
issues: list[DiagnosticIssue],
recommendations: list[Recommendation],
) -> None:
"""Check for excessive redundancy."""
if quality.redundancy > thresholds.max_redundancy:
severity = "critical" if quality.redundancy > thresholds.max_redundancy * 1.5 else "warning"
issues.append(
DiagnosticIssue(
severity=severity,
category="redundancy",
message=f"High redundancy ({quality.redundancy:.2f}) exceeds threshold ({thresholds.max_redundancy:.2f})",
evidence={"redundancy": quality.redundancy, "threshold": thresholds.max_redundancy},
)
)
recommendations.append(
Recommendation(
action="enable-redundancy-filter",
description="Enable redundancy elimination to remove duplicate information",
suggested_change={"redundancy_threshold": 0.8},
estimated_impact="Could reduce context size by 10-30% while preserving information",
)
)
def _analyze_freshness(
quality: ContextQuality,
thresholds: QualityThresholds,
issues: list[DiagnosticIssue],
recommendations: list[Recommendation],
) -> None:
"""Check for stale context."""
if quality.freshness < thresholds.min_freshness:
severity = "warning" if quality.freshness > 0.0 else "critical"
issues.append(
DiagnosticIssue(
severity=severity,
category="stale-context",
message=f"Low freshness ({quality.freshness:.2f}) below threshold ({thresholds.min_freshness:.2f})",
evidence={"freshness": quality.freshness, "threshold": thresholds.min_freshness},
)
)
recommendations.append(
Recommendation(
action="adjust-weights",
description="Increase recency weight to prioritize fresher context",
suggested_change={"recency": 1.5},
estimated_impact="Model will use more up-to-date information",
)
)
def _analyze_diversity(
quality: ContextQuality,
thresholds: QualityThresholds,
issues: list[DiagnosticIssue],
recommendations: list[Recommendation],
) -> None:
"""Check for low diversity."""
if quality.diversity < thresholds.min_diversity:
issues.append(
DiagnosticIssue(
severity="warning",
category="low-diversity",
message=f"Low diversity ({quality.diversity:.2f}) below threshold ({thresholds.min_diversity:.2f})",
evidence={"diversity": quality.diversity, "threshold": thresholds.min_diversity},
)
)
recommendations.append(
Recommendation(
action="add-kind",
description="Include more diverse item kinds to improve context variety",
suggested_change={"add_kinds": ["docs", "examples", "memory"]},
estimated_impact="Broader context diversity improves model reasoning",
)
)
def _analyze_utilization(
pack_result: ContextPack,
thresholds: QualityThresholds,
issues: list[DiagnosticIssue],
recommendations: list[Recommendation],
) -> None:
"""Check budget utilization."""
utilization = (
pack_result.total_tokens / pack_result.budget.max_tokens
if pack_result.budget.max_tokens > 0
else 0.0
)
if utilization < thresholds.min_utilization:
issues.append(
DiagnosticIssue(
severity="info",
category="budget-waste",
message=f"Low budget utilization ({utilization:.1%}) — context window is underused",
evidence={
"utilization": round(utilization, 3),
"tokens_used": pack_result.total_tokens,
"budget": pack_result.budget.max_tokens,
},
)
)
recommendations.append(
Recommendation(
action="increase-budget",
description="Budget is significantly underused; consider adding more context or reducing budget",
suggested_change={"max_tokens": pack_result.total_tokens + 500},
estimated_impact="Right-sizing budget saves cost without losing context",
)
)
if utilization > thresholds.max_utilization:
issues.append(
DiagnosticIssue(
severity="warning",
category="budget-waste",
message=f"Budget nearly full ({utilization:.1%}) — important items may be dropped",
evidence={
"utilization": round(utilization, 3),
"dropped_count": len(pack_result.dropped),
},
)
)
recommendations.append(
Recommendation(
action="enable-compression",
description="Enable compression to fit more items within budget",
suggested_change={"allow_compression": True},
estimated_impact="Compression can save 20-50% tokens per item",
)
)
def _analyze_dropped(
pack_result: ContextPack,
query: str | None,
) -> DroppedAnalysis:
"""Analyze dropped items for diagnostic insight."""
dropped = pack_result.dropped
dropped_by_kind: dict[str, int] = {}
for item in dropped:
kind = item.kind or "unknown"
dropped_by_kind[kind] = dropped_by_kind.get(kind, 0) + 1
# High-priority dropped items (priority >= 7 on 0-10 scale).
high_priority_dropped = [item for item in dropped if (item.priority or 0) >= 7]
# Potentially relevant dropped items (if query provided).
potentially_relevant: list[ContextItem] = []
if query and dropped:
q = normalize_query(query)
for item in dropped:
relevance = compute_relevance(q, item)
if relevance > 0.3:
potentially_relevant.append(item)
return DroppedAnalysis(
total_dropped=len(dropped),
dropped_by_kind=dropped_by_kind,
high_priority_dropped=high_priority_dropped,
potentially_relevant=potentially_relevant,
)
def _analyze_priorities(
pack_result: ContextPack,
issues: list[DiagnosticIssue],
recommendations: list[Recommendation],
) -> None:
"""Check whether high-priority items were dropped while low-priority kept."""
if not pack_result.dropped:
return
max_dropped_priority = max((item.priority or 0.0) for item in pack_result.dropped)
if not pack_result.selected:
return
min_selected_priority = min((item.priority or 0.0) for item in pack_result.selected)
if max_dropped_priority > min_selected_priority and max_dropped_priority >= 5.0:
issues.append(
DiagnosticIssue(
severity="warning",
category="wrong-priorities",
message=(
f"High-priority items dropped (max={max_dropped_priority:.1f}) "
f"while lower-priority items kept (min={min_selected_priority:.1f})"
),
evidence={
"max_dropped_priority": max_dropped_priority,
"min_selected_priority": min_selected_priority,
},
)
)
recommendations.append(
Recommendation(
action="adjust-weights",
description="Increase priority weight to ensure important items are selected first",
suggested_change={"priority": 2.0},
estimated_impact="Critical context items will be consistently included",
)
)
def _analyze_missing_context(
quality: ContextQuality,
thresholds: QualityThresholds,
issues: list[DiagnosticIssue],
recommendations: list[Recommendation],
) -> None:
"""Check for low density indicating missing useful context."""
if quality.density < thresholds.min_density:
issues.append(
DiagnosticIssue(
severity="warning",
category="missing-context",
message=f"Low information density ({quality.density:.2f}) below threshold ({thresholds.min_density:.2f})",
evidence={"density": quality.density, "threshold": thresholds.min_density},
)
)
recommendations.append(
Recommendation(
action="add-kind",
description="Add more information-rich context items to improve density",
suggested_change={"add_kinds": ["code", "docs"]},
estimated_impact="Higher density context leads to more accurate model outputs",
)
)
def _determine_health(issues: list[DiagnosticIssue]) -> str:
"""Determine overall health from issues."""
severities = {issue.severity for issue in issues}
if "critical" in severities:
return "critical"
if "warning" in severities:
return "warning"
return "good"
# ---------------------------------------------------------------------------
# ContextDebugger
# ---------------------------------------------------------------------------
class ContextDebugger:
"""Diagnoses context quality issues and produces recommendations."""
def __init__(self, thresholds: QualityThresholds | None = None) -> None:
self._thresholds = thresholds or QualityThresholds()
def diagnose(self, pack_result: ContextPack, query: str | None = None) -> Diagnosis:
"""Run a full diagnostic on a context pack.
1. Analyze quality metrics via analyze_context().
2. Analyze dropped items.
3. Run all analyzers (redundancy, freshness, diversity, utilization,
priorities, missing context).
4. Determine overall health.
Args:
pack_result: The ContextPack to diagnose.
query: Optional query for relevance-based checks.
Returns:
Diagnosis with health status, issues, and recommendations.
"""
quality = analyze_context(pack_result.selected)
issues: list[DiagnosticIssue] = []
recommendations: list[Recommendation] = []
# Run all analyzers.
_analyze_redundancy(quality, self._thresholds, issues, recommendations)
_analyze_freshness(quality, self._thresholds, issues, recommendations)
_analyze_diversity(quality, self._thresholds, issues, recommendations)
_analyze_utilization(pack_result, self._thresholds, issues, recommendations)
_analyze_priorities(pack_result, issues, recommendations)
_analyze_missing_context(quality, self._thresholds, issues, recommendations)
# Dropped analysis.
dropped_analysis = _analyze_dropped(pack_result, query)
if dropped_analysis.high_priority_dropped:
issues.append(
DiagnosticIssue(
severity="critical",
category="wrong-priorities",
message=f"{len(dropped_analysis.high_priority_dropped)} high-priority items were dropped",
evidence={
"dropped_ids": [item.id for item in dropped_analysis.high_priority_dropped],
},
)
)
overall_health = _determine_health(issues)
return Diagnosis(
overall_health=overall_health,
quality=quality,
issues=issues,
recommendations=recommendations,
dropped_analysis=dropped_analysis,
)
def proactive_check(
self,
items: list[ContextItem],
budget: Budget,
query: str | None = None,
) -> Diagnosis:
"""Simulate packing and diagnose the result proactively.
Args:
items: Items to pack.
budget: Token budget.
query: Optional query for relevance checks.
Returns:
Diagnosis of the simulated pack.
"""
result = pack(items, budget)
return self.diagnose(result, query)
def compare_responses(
self,
pack_a: ContextPack,
quality_a: float,
pack_b: ContextPack,
quality_b: float,
) -> ComparisonResult:
"""Compare two context packs and their output quality.
Args:
pack_a: First context pack.
quality_a: Quality score (0-1) of outputs from pack_a.
pack_b: Second context pack.
quality_b: Quality score (0-1) of outputs from pack_b.
Returns:
ComparisonResult with quality analysis and insights.
"""
qa = analyze_context(pack_a.selected)
qb = analyze_context(pack_b.selected)
ids_a = {item.id for item in pack_a.selected}
ids_b = {item.id for item in pack_b.selected}
item_diff = {
"only_in_a": sorted(ids_a - ids_b),
"only_in_b": sorted(ids_b - ids_a),
"shared": sorted(ids_a & ids_b),
}
quality_delta = quality_b - quality_a
insights: list[str] = []
# Generate insights.
if abs(quality_delta) > 0.1:
better = "B" if quality_delta > 0 else "A"
insights.append(
f"Pack {better} produced significantly better outputs (delta={quality_delta:+.2f})"
)
if qa.redundancy > qb.redundancy + 0.1:
insights.append("Pack A has higher redundancy — deduplication may help")
elif qb.redundancy > qa.redundancy + 0.1:
insights.append("Pack B has higher redundancy — deduplication may help")
if qa.diversity > qb.diversity + 0.1:
insights.append("Pack A has more diverse context")
elif qb.diversity > qa.diversity + 0.1:
insights.append("Pack B has more diverse context")
if qa.freshness > qb.freshness + 0.1:
insights.append("Pack A has fresher context")
elif qb.freshness > qa.freshness + 0.1:
insights.append("Pack B has fresher context")
only_in_better = item_diff["only_in_b"] if quality_delta > 0 else item_diff["only_in_a"]
if only_in_better:
insights.append(f"Items unique to the better pack: {', '.join(only_in_better[:5])}")
return ComparisonResult(
pack_a_quality=qa,
pack_b_quality=qb,
item_diff=item_diff,
quality_delta=round(quality_delta, 4),
insights=insights,
)
def create_context_debugger(
thresholds: QualityThresholds | None = None,
) -> ContextDebugger:
"""Factory for context debugger."""
return ContextDebugger(thresholds)
